AI Summary
-
Reduces the number of members representing agencies serving aging persons from 4 to 3 and members representing agencies serving persons with physical disabilities from 4 to 3, maintaining a 15-member council overall.
-
Adds 2 new council members from public or nonprofit agencies that provide services to alleged victims as defined in Title 31, § 3902.
-
Changes the Council chair election from annual to a 2-year term, with the chair alternating between representatives of the aging community and representatives of adults with physical disabilities.
-
Absorbs the role of the Adult Protective Services Advisory Council (under Title 31, § 3903) into the Council on Services for Aging and Adults with Physical Disabilities.
-
Makes technical corrections to conform the statute language to Delaware Legislative Drafting Manual standards, including changes from "shall" to present tense verbs.
Legislative Description
An Act To Amend Title 29 Of The Delaware Code Relating To The Council On Services For Aging And Adults With Physical Disabilities.
